Welcome to West Los Angeles (WLA), a vibrant and eclectic neighborhood that perfectly encapsulates the dynamic spirit of Los Angeles. Nestled between the bustling streets of Santa Monica and the serene charm of Culver City, WLA boasts a unique blend of urban convenience and suburban tranquility. With its diverse community, rich cultural offerings, and proximity to iconic landmarks, this area is an ideal place for both residents and businesses alike.

One of the standout features of West Los Angeles is its mixed-use housing options, which cater to a variety of lifestyles. Homes with a mixed-use subtype allow residents to enjoy the convenience of living above or adjacent to their favorite shops, restaurants, and offices. Imagine stepping out of your stylish abode and finding yourself just moments away from artisanal cafes, trendy boutiques, and vibrant art galleries. This seamless integration of living and working spaces fosters a sense of community and convenience that is hard to beat.

The architectural landscape in WLA is as diverse as its residents, featuring everything from modern condos to charming bungalows, all designed to accommodate the dynamic lifestyle of the area. Whether you’re a young professional seeking a trendy loft or a family looking for a spacious home with easy access to local amenities, West Los Angeles has something for everyone.

We are pleased to present 1626 S. Barrington Avenue, an exceptional 11-unit apartment building situated in one of West Los Angeles' most desirable and sought-after rental neighborhoods. This professionally managed asset reflects long-term ownership and pride of stewardship, making it an ideal addition to any multifamily investment portfolio. Constructed in 1969, the property features a well-balanced unit mix consisting of six one-bedroom units, three studio units, one two-bedroom unit, and a spacious townhouse-style front unit offering three bedrooms, three bathrooms, and in-unit laundry. This diverse configuration appeals to a broad tenant base and provides for minimal vacancy. The majority of the building is separately metered and designed for efficient management. Amenities include a dedicated on-site laundry room, bike storage, and gated parking for most units, including some enclosed garages. Current Soft-story and Balcony requirements have been met. Current rents remain below market, creating a compelling value-add opportunity through natural turnover and strategic interior improvements. At the current income level, the property offers an attractive 5% capitalization rate, with substantial upside potential through rent growth and enhanced operations. Offering convenient access to the I-405 Freeway, major surface streets, and public transportation, including the Metro E Line, the property is ideally positioned to attract a diverse tenant base seeking connectivity to the Westside's premier employment, educational, cultural, and recreational destinations. These highly desirable location attributes continue to support strong occupancy levels and long-term rental demand. 1626 S. Barrington Avenue represents a rare opportunity to acquire a stable, well-maintained Westside multifamily asset with immediate cash flow, long-term appreciation potential, and significant future income growth in one of Los Angeles' most resilient rental markets.
